In this episode, Lorraine and I chat about what it is like to transition from a corporate role or job to becoming an entrepreneur. We also chat about the basics of becoming an entrepreneur.
Lorraine Beaman is a Principal at Interview2work, the company she founded after a career in post-secondary education and outplacement services. Ms. Beaman utilizes her 25+ years’ experience in interview coaching, salary negotiation, and employee onboarding to help clients turn job searches into rewarding career opportunities.
Lorraine earned a bachelor’s degree from the University of California, Berkeley, and a master’s degree from California State University, Chico. Her professional certifications include the ACRW, NCRW, and ACC. Her Facebook page is committed to sharing career-advancing strategies.
